Lactate Dehydrogenase  (LDH)
|
| Synonyms:
| LDH |
| Specimen: | Blood; (1) SST (serum separator), Red (no preservative) or Green (lithium heparin) top vacutianer tube. |
| Volume: | Full primary tube |
| Minimum Volume: | 100 microL serum or plasma |
| Collection: | If tube other than an SST is collected, transfer serum or plasma to a tightly capped plastic aliquot tube within 2 hours of collection for transport.
Refrigerate at 2-8°C for 7 days. |
| Rejection Criteria: | Hemolysis; improper labeling. |
| Reference Range: | 100-216 units/L |
